Great Wall PC to produce $100 laptopThe promotion of 100 US dollar laptops by One Laptop Per Child association has been pressed slowly forward in China. Las week Nicholas Negroponte, professor of Massachusetts Institute of Technology, and founder of the One Laptop per Child non-profit association reappeared in Beijng with his $100 laptop sample. At the same time news revealed that the China's mainland Great Wall PC had begun cooperative talks in producing $100 laptops with Nicholas. On Thursday the news was confirmed. Great Wall PC marketing director Huang Maoqing approved that the negotiation was on going. If the final consensus is reached, the $100 laptop will be on sale under the tag of Great Wall in China. Huang also acknowledged that the cost of the laptop is about between 180 to 200 yuan, so it is surely to lose money in this program. However, through cooperation, they will be authorized some patent technology applied in the laptop, which they will use in other programs. In fact attaining brand effect is the greatest motive for Great Wall PC. Huang said, "We should first implement the negotiating issues, then promotion work will be launched. There is still a long way to go for the $100 laptop before entering China." In his opinion the talking brand effect is a little bit too early. It is revealed that the first generation $100 laptops are produced by substitution in the factory of Quanta Computer in Shanghai Songjiang. The production has already been started after a test, and the first set of products hold prospects to enter market in late July. In the middle of next year the second generation will face the consumers. The estimated retail price is about US$135. By People's Daily Online |
